Understanding Process Improvement
Process improvement is a systematic approach aimed at identifying and removing waste from a process to improve quality and efficiency. It involves various methodologies, such as Six Sigma, Lean, and others, to enhance the performance of organizations of all sizes.
Industrial Engineering
Industrial Engineering (IE) is a discipline that focuses on the design, improvement, and development of integrated systems of people, materials, information, equipment, and energy. IE majors learn to apply scientific and mathematical methods to solve complex engineering problems, with a strong emphasis on process improvement.
System-Thinking Approach: IE graduates often possess a system-thinking mindset, making them ideal candidates for roles that require a holistic view of processes and systems.
Problem-Solving Skills: Their training in problem-solving techniques prepares them to tackle real-world challenges and optimize processes.
Supply Chain Management
Another major that extensively covers process improvement is Supply Chain Management (SCM). SCM deals with the flow of goods and services from suppliers to customers, encompassing manufacturing, warehousing, and distribution processes.
Comprehensive Approach: SCM students learn to manage the entire supply chain, from procurement to delivery, thereby focusing on optimizing the overall process.
Interdisciplinary Skills: SCM combines elements of logistics, finance, and management to create an efficient supply chain system.
General Business Majors
While not as focused as Industrial Engineering or Supply Chain Management, general business majors also cover aspects of process improvement. However, it is typically at a lesser depth and requires additional specialized courses for deeper knowledge.
Lesser Depth: General business majors may include some courses on process improvement, but they are usually part of a broader business education.
Advanced Studies: For those interested in process improvement, additional courses or a minor in Six Sigma, Lean methodology, or other relevant fields can provide the necessary depth.
Postgraduate Certificates and Training
Many organizations and educational institutions offer postgraduate certificates in process improvement methodologies such as Six Sigma and Lean. These programs are designed to provide individuals with the necessary skills and knowledge to implement these methodologies in real-world scenarios.
Six Sigma Certification: Six Sigma certification is widely recognized and can significantly enhance your career prospects in process improvement.
Lean Certification: Lean certification focuses on eliminating waste and improving process efficiency, making it highly valuable for many industries.
Other Methodologies: There are numerous other process improvement methodologies, such as Theory of Constraints (TOC), DMAIC (Define, Measure, Analyze, Improve, Control), and others, each with its own set of techniques and certifications.
Career Opportunities in Process Improvement
The skills gained through studying process improvement are highly transferable across various industries, making graduates from these fields highly employable. Here are some of the career paths you can pursue:
Process Improvement Analyst: Work in manufacturing, healthcare, software development, and other sectors to identify and implement process improvements.
Quality Assurance Manager: Ensure that products and services meet the highest standards of quality.
Supply Chain Specialist: Manage and optimize supply chains to improve efficiency and reduce costs.
Operations Manager: Oversee the day-to-day operations of a business, focusing on process efficiency and optimization.
